If you are experiencing challenges in your sexual relationship, you may feel embarrassed, confused, or hesitant to talk about it. Concerns around desire, arousal, pain, performance anxiety, past trauma, or mismatched expectations can quietly impact connection and intimacy. Many couples struggle in this area more than they realize, yet rarely feel safe enough to seek support.
At Selah Counselling, we approach sex therapy with professionalism, sensitivity, and respect. Sexual health is a meaningful part of overall relational and emotional well-being. In a safe, confidential space, we explore the physical, emotional, relational, and, when desired, spiritual factors that may influence intimacy. Our work may include improving communication, addressing anxiety or trauma responses, strengthening connections, and building realistic, mutually satisfying expectations. The goal is to restore comfort, clarity, and deeper intimacy in a way that honours both individuals and the relationship as a whole.

Sex Therapy therapists in Dartmouth, Nova Scotia, Canada Statistics
Sex Therapy therapists in Dartmouth, Nova Scotia, Canada average 12 years of experience and charge around $178 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Internal Family Systems (IFS) (77%),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) (69%), and Existential / Humanistic Therapy (62%).
